Memory is generally arranged in one of a two ways: single and dual ranks. You can also get dimms with 4 ranks, but they aren't common.

On some systems you can't mix single rank and dual rank memory sticks, and that's what you've done:
DIMM0 (RAS 0, RAS 1) : 512 (Single Bank)
DIMM1 (RAS 2, RAS 3) : 512 (Double Bank)

It used to be that single sided dimms had a single rank and double sided dimms had dual rank. But that's not always the case any more, particularly on SODIMMs.

You will need to exchange one of the memory sticks for one that it matches the layout of the remaining stick.

I also notice that the sticks have different speeds. That's not a good idea either, but it is unlikely to be causing this particular problem.

Best thing when adding more memory is to match the existing memory as closely as possible.
